So here’s my mind process whenever BEFORE I buy ANYTHING:
1. Search on Google, “Product Coupon”. For example, if you were buying Dell Inspiron 1525, you can type “Dell Inspiron 1525” on Google.
2. Find the coupon and use it!
Now, do this as a habit anytime you are buying something over $100, it will save you a LOT of money.
